d1540c05056cebb5b571fa98464682c14d168e7c977fb3d7207a88515d327db6

1788254 (1906 blocks ago)

⏴ Block 1788253 (3fda29d0...f25) | Block 1788255 ⏵ | Latest block ⏭

Metadata

19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details